| Name | Ellis Henwood Best |
|---|---|
| Birth Place | Oxford, Oxfordshire, England, 1892. Son of John Ellis Best and Clara Best, of Oxford Lodge Crosby Rd., Westcliff-on-sea, Essex. |
| Residence | Westcliff-on-sea. Auctioneers Apprentice |
| Death Date | 16 Nov 1917 |
| Death Place | Palestine |
| Enlistment Place | Hull |
| RegimentOO | Household Cavalry and Cavalry of the Line |
| Battalion | East Riding of Yorkshire Yeomanry |
| Regimental Number | 50331 |
| Type of Casualty | Killed in action |
| Theatre of War | Egyptian Theatre – JERUSALEM MEMORIAL, ISRAEL |
